Another storm system is bearing down on us from the west as cleanup continues in parts of Georgia where the weekend storms did damage.

“Severe thunderstorms could impact north and central Georgia on Thursday,” the National Weather Service (NWS) said in a noontime advisory Wednesday. “The risk will be highest between 4 PM and midnight, with damaging winds gusts to 60 mph and hail near the size of quarters being the main hazards.”

For now, it looks like the strongest of the storms will impact Alabama and Mississippi and a tiny section of northwest Georgia.
